Super high-rise building concrete construction template reinforcing apparatus
Technical Field
The utility model relates to a template reinforcing field, in particular to super high-rise building concrete construction template reinforcing apparatus.
Background
The building formwork is a temporary supporting structure, which is manufactured according to the design requirements, so that the concrete structure and the members are formed according to the specified positions and geometric dimensions, the correct positions of the concrete structure and the members are kept, and the self weight of the building formwork and the external load acting on the building formwork are borne. The publication No. CN212533641U discloses a formwork reinforcing device and a formwork reinforcing system, the device supports and reinforces the formwork through the matching of a supporting plate and a fixing plate, however, no corresponding supporting point exists outside the building during the concrete construction of the super high-rise building, and the purpose of reinforcing the formwork can not be achieved.

2. The reinforcing device for the concrete construction formwork of the super high-rise building according to claim 1, characterized in that: a movable groove is formed in the movable clamping seat (3), and the movable sliding block (604) is movably arranged in the movable groove.
3. The super high-rise building concrete construction formwork reinforcing device of claim 2, characterized in that: one end of the reset spring (605) is fixedly connected to the bottom of the movable sliding groove, the other end of the reset spring (605) is fixedly connected to the movable sliding block (604), one end of the reset pull rod (603) is fixedly connected to the connecting support leg (602), and the other end of the reset pull rod (603) is fixedly connected to the movable sliding block (604).
4. The super high-rise building concrete construction formwork reinforcing device of claim 3, characterized in that: an installation notch (504) is formed in the forward pushing screw rod (502), and the rotating rod (505) is installed on the forward pushing screw rod (502) through the installation notch (504).
5. The super high-rise building concrete construction formwork reinforcing device of claim 4, characterized in that: the movable clamping seat is characterized in that a mounting groove is formed in the movable clamping seat (3), the screw sleeve (503) is mounted on the movable clamping seat (3) through the mounting groove, and the forward pushing screw (502) is movably mounted on the movable clamping seat (3) through the screw sleeve (503).
6. The super high-rise building concrete construction formwork reinforcing device of claim 5, characterized in that: the movable clamping device is characterized in that a movable hole is formed in the movable clamping seat (3), the movable clamping seat (3) is movably mounted on the clamping frame body (2) through the movable hole, and the movable clamping seat (3) is limited on the clamping frame body (2) through a limiting mechanism (6).
